How noise stresses your dog
Dogs hear far more finely than we do. Constant noise is a real stress factor for them. How to provide more acoustic calm in your dog's everyday life.
Dogs hear considerably more finely and over a wider range than we humans do. What sounds like a normal background hum to us can be exhausting for a dog. Ongoing noise is therefore an often underestimated stress factor that frays the nerves and can make a dog ill.
Where noise comes from
Sources of stress are, for example, a constantly running television, loud music, building-site noise, echoing rooms or a hectic household with lots of sounds. Individual loud events such as fireworks or thunderstorms can also strain dogs greatly, especially noise-sensitive ones. We barely notice much of this, but for the fine-eared dog it's much more present.
